# Company Sync Settings

> Configure how companies are searched, created, and mapped between HubSpot and Tripletex.

Use **Company Sync Settings** to control how the app finds existing customers in Tripletex and how company data is mapped from HubSpot.

## Search parameter

Select the sync search parameter to decide which field in HubSpot should be used to search for existing customers in Tripletex.

Choose a field that is likely to be unique and reliable, such as:

* Email
* Phone number
* VAT number

<Note>
  If the field you choose for the search is missing, the sync can fail.
</Note>

## Tripletex customer number preference

Go to the **Tripletex customer number preference** section.

You can create a new customer only when the customer is **not found** in Tripletex.

You have two options:

### 1. Let Tripletex create the customer number

Choose **Let Tripletex create the customer number** if you want Tripletex to automatically generate the customer number when a new customer is created.

Then select which HubSpot field should store that generated customer number.

### 2. Take Tripletex customer number from HubSpot

Choose **Take Tripletex customer number from HubSpot** if you want a HubSpot field to supply the customer number that will be used in Tripletex.

## Company field mappings

Use **Company field mappings** to control which HubSpot company properties should populate fields in Tripletex when a new customer is created.

Some mappings may already be added by default.

To update mappings:

1. Open the mapping area on the right side
2. Click **Actions**
3. Select **Edit Mapping**

<Note>
  Set up a consistent search field and customer-number strategy before enabling sync. This helps avoid duplicate customers and makes future lookups more reliable.
</Note>
